Development of power lines

The development of power lines is a key aspect in ensuring stability and reliability of electricity supply. Analyzes carried out in various research centers and experiences related to the occurrence of temporary supply deficiencies confirm that the main problem of the power line is their availability, i.e. the ability to function even in the case of exceptional random events. The further development of the power network is expected to develop at all levels of voltage, adapted to the growing energy demand and requirements for energy transmission over long distances.

However, this development often encounters social resistance, especially in the case of the planned construction of new overhead lines near inhabited areas. Local communities often protest against such investments, fearing a negative impact on the surroundings and health of residents. In such situations, negotiations and promotional activities undertaken by investors rarely bring the expected results. Therefore, alternative solutions, such as compact poles constructions or the construction of multi -track lines on existing overhead routes, are increasingly considering.

Analyzing the tendencies of the development of support structures of power lines, it can be seen that for practical reasons, multi -trade overhead, multiplication lines in compact performances will be increasingly being built. This is the result of the need to adapt energy infrastructure to the growing energy demand, while minimizing environmental impact and obtaining social acceptance.

On the one hand, there is an urgent need to develop a power network to meet the growing demand for electricity. On the other hand, it is becoming more and more difficult to obtain social consent for the construction of high and highest voltage overhead lines. Therefore, it can be predicted that in the near future there will be further development of the cable network, despite some technical and economic restrictions.
